Otay-Tijuana Venture LLC, a group of U.S.-Mexican companies operating CBX, the Tijuana Cross Border Xpress International Airport, has chosen RealNetworks' video analytics technology, SAFR® to be used throughout the San Diego - Tijuana terminal in order to optimize passenger flow efficiency and overall operational processes.
The first building connecting the United States to a foreign airport terminal, CBX serves millions of passengers crossing the border as part of their journey, helping them avoid unforeseen delays at the congested San Ysidro and Otay border crossings.

The 390-foot-long bridge is a hub for many everyday situations where technology, process, and people work together to create a safe and efficient passenger experience. Artificial intelligence-based video analytics technology ensures that CBX staff have actionable data at their fingertips as they monitor passenger flows and make real-time decisions.

SAFR offers highly accurate, fast, low-bias facial recognition and additional face- and person-based computer vision features. SAFR's NIST (National Institute of Standards and Technology) scores for speed, accuracy, and bias combine to distinguish SAFR as a leader in real-world accuracy and performance.
• Optimized for live video: Face detection and recognition of a subject moving through a video frame in less than 100 ms with 99.87% accuracy
• Low bias: The lowest accuracy difference between groups of different skin tones of any non-Chinese algorithm tested by NIST in its January 2020 report. This is a direct result of various training data used to develop the SAFR algorithm and intentional focused efforts to eliminate bias.
• Deployment flexibility: In addition to fixed live video sources, SAFR SDKs support edge deployments on standalone devices with limited resources such as UGVs or iOT devices.
• Global trust: Tens of millions of recognitions per month worldwide with active customers both on-premises and with hybrid cloud deployments.
SAFR has added additional features specifically designed to help customers respond to the global COVID-19 pandemic, including mask detection and occupancy counting. CBX has applied the mask detection feature to passenger flow monitoring to better track mask compliance and collect critical operations data.
